Olha só, eu tive um problema com o 4.8-STABLE compilado acho que no dia 21 de Agosto. Desse dia pra ca eu nunca mais usei 4.8-STABLE, troquei todos os servidores FreeBSD de RELENG_4 para RELENG_4_8.

A versão 4.9-PRERELEASE esta tendo muitos problemas, o pessoal na FreeBSD-Stable anda falando toda hora de problemas com essa versão.

NOTE: This schedule is currently out of date as unanticipated stability problems were introduced with the PAE MFCs. Over the next 2 weeks we will try to correct those problems. On September 30 we will have either fixed the stability issues, or we will back out the PAE import and move forward with the 4.9 release without PAE. In either case, the release will be delayed at least 2 weeks from its original schedule, and picking exact dates will be difficult until the PAE decision has been made

21.2.2.1 What Is FreeBSD-STABLE?
FreeBSD-STABLE is our development branch from which major releases are made. Changes go into this branch at a different pace, and with the general assumption that they have first gone into FreeBSD-CURRENT for testing. This is still a development branch, however, and this means that at any given time, the sources for FreeBSD-STABLE may or may not be suitable for any particular purpose. It is simply another engineering development track, not a resource for end-users.
